Coal mine gas concentration exceeds standard alarm circuit

(2) Alarm principle: When the indoor combustible gas
concentration is within the allowable range (lower than the limit value)
, the gas sensor A and B are connected. The value is larger. The voltage of pin ① of lC is low, the multivibrator does not work, and there is no sound from the speaker BL.
When the gas in the mine exceeds the limit, the resistance between the A and B terminals of the gas sensor QM-N5 decreases, causing the voltage of pin ① of the IC to be higher than
the conversion voltage of Dl in the IC. The multivibrator works and starts from the IC. The ④ pin outputs an oscillation signal. After the signal is amplified by VT, it drives the speaker BL
to sound an alarm. Adjust the resistance value of R2 so that the voltage between gas sensor a and b is 4.5V.
